HRT hits the shelves

-

A win for menopausal women – hormone replacemen­t therapy (HRT) is available over the counter. The first type of HRT to become available at pharmacies without a prescripti­on is called Gina. The vaginal tablets treat symptoms such as vaginal dryness, itching, burning and uncomforta­ble sex, and can be taken by women aged 50 years and over who have not had a period for at least one year.
